KR And HD HHI Announce Partnership On Ammonia Fuel Supply System At GASTECH 2024

At GASTECH 2024 in Houston, KR (Korean Register) announced on September 17 that it had sign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with HD Hyundai Heavy Industries (HD HHI) to develop an enhanced ammonia fuel supply system. The International Maritime Organization (IMO) has established a target to achieve net-zero greenhouse gas emissions by 2050. ABS celebrates AMVER Awards at SMM maritime conference

In a biannual tradition accompanying the SMM maritime conference, ABS celebrated the AMVER Awards by sponsoring a ceremony recognising the contribution of German owners to the unique AMVER reporting system that supports search and rescue efforts for distress calls at sea. Wallenius Wilhelmsen's biofuel verification by DNV

At the SMM trade fair, DNV awarded shipping and logistics company - Wallenius Wilhelmsen its first biofuel insetting verification statement - recognising the company’s use of B100 in a recent voyage. Biofuels can help to make an immediate impact on shipping’s GHG emissions. However, they do come at an increased cost and owners need to be sure that they can benefit from their extra investments in sustainability and compliance. HPWS wins approval for ammonia-fueled ships at SMM

At the SMM trade fair in Hamburg, DNV awarded Huangpu Wenchong Shipbuilding Company (HPWS) three approval in principle (AiP) certificates for their innovative designs of three new ship types.  Three new designs  An ammonia-fueled 43,000 cbm midsize gas carrier (MGC)  An ammonia-fueled SWAN 3,500 TEU container ship, and  A LNG dual-fueled SWAN 1,300 TEU container ship with ice class. Posidonia 2024: T.E.N. contracts DNV for first shuttle tanker with Cyber Secure notation

At the Posidonia trade fair, the classification society DNV presented Tsakos Energy Navigation Ltd (T.E.N.) with a certificate recognising their recently contracted vessels as the first shuttle tankers set to receive the DNV Cyber Secure Essential notation. The vessels, scheduled for completion from Samsung Heavy Industries (SHI) in 2025, will be compliant with the upcoming IACS Unified Requirements (UR) E26/27 ahead of its implementation.
